Book 1:"CNC Programming handbook" by Peter Smid

Frequently cited as a bible for CNC machining,Peter Smid's "CNC Programming Handbook" is an indispensable resource for both novice and experienced programmers. Smid,a recognized authority on CNC programming,fills this work with detailed explanations,step-by-step procedures,and numerous examples.

By delving into this masterpiece,readers get a vast exposure to CNC's fundamentals,including coding,coordinates,and control functions. Smid also engages the readers in working with advanced topics such as canned cycles,machining centers,and creating custom macros.

Book 2:"CNC Machining Handbook:Basic Theory,Production Data,and Machining Procedures" by Alan Overby

Alan Overby adroitly parleys his expansive knowledge into a comprehensive guide with "CNC Machining Handbook:Basic Theory,Production Data,and Machining Procedures." This book is known for its simplistic approach to explaining complex topics.

Overby–s book primarily targets beginners by carefully explaining the basics of CNC machining and progressively building towards more complex topics. The extensive focus on the practical side,including real-world examples of problems encountered and solved,makes the book a precious resource for budding machinists.

Book 3:"CNC Trade Secrets:A Guide to CNC Machine Shop Practices" by James Harvey

James Harvey's "CNC Trade Secrets:A Guide to CNC Machine Shop Practices" conceptually addresses real strategies and techniques adopted by experienced machinists. It incorporates numerous shop-tested tips and secrets that are seldom covered in traditional educational curriculum.

Harvey presents a practical perspective on subjects like setting up a job,selecting optimal tools and procedures,and making parts to specification. Those looking for a peek behind the curtain of actual CNC machining practices will find this an insightful read,helping them gain operational skills in rapid order.

Book 4:"Programming of CNC Machines" by Ken Evans

Ken Evans,in his masterpiece "Programming of CNC Machines," offers a very systematic and elaborate learning platform for individuals coming from different backgrounds. The author widens the knowledge base for learners by exhibiting a hands-on approach and real-world examples.

The book revolves primarily around CNC program writing,but it also covers subjects like tooling,machine setup,and G\&M codes. Notably,Evans introduces the concepts through easy-to-understand instructions in combination with expansive illustrations,making it a perfect fit for visual learners.

Book 5:"Mastering CAD/CAM" by Ibrahim Zeid

Lastly,"Mastering CAD/CAM" by Ibrahim Zeid stands out with its focus on the relationship between CNC machining and computer-aided design (CAD) and computer-aided manufacturing (CAM). Zeid–s book is practically oriented and includes a range of projects demonstrating how to use CAD/CAM software in different machining applications.

"Mastering CAD/CAM" offers a comprehensive overview of the importance and implementation of CAD/CAM technology in CNC machining. With the inclusion of a plethora of exercises,real-world examples,and fundamental explanations,this book is immensely useful for people keen on making the most out of digital manufacturing.
